Summary

Salisbury High is a public high school located in Salisbury, North Carolina, serving grades 9-12 with a total enrollment of 1,014 students. The school is part of the Rowan-Salisbury Schools district, which is ranked 207 out of 242 districts in the state and has a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Salisbury High consistently ranks in the bottom half of North Carolina high schools, maintaining a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ger for the past 7 years. The school struggles across various student subgroups, with most groups ranking in the bottom half or bottom quarter of state high schools. Salisbury High's proficiency rates on End-of-Course (EOC) exams are significantly below the state and district averages across all subject areas, with the highest proficiency rate at 43.5% in English II and the lowest at 5.6% in Math I. While the school's four-year graduation rates have hovered around 87-88% in recent years, this is slightly below the state average.

Interestingly, the nearby high schools in the Rowan-Salisbury district, such as West Rowan High, South Rowan High, Carson High, and East Rowan High, generally outperform Salisbury High across various metrics. Additionally, Rowan County Early College, a small public high school located just 1.86 miles from Salisbury High, stands out as a high-performing outlier within the district, ranking among the top 20% of North Carolina high schools.

Frequently Asked Questions about Salisbury High

Students at Salisbury High are 43% African American, 34% Hispanic, 15% White, 6% Two or more races, 1% Asian.

Salisbury High ranks in the bottom 8.6% of North Carolina high schools.

In the 2024-25 school year, 930 students attended Salisbury High.
